Output 8c88a397196e3086d54ca2b5fe711466bd118b348624061dc7fb7dac17578384:35

value
26662187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cd933dc26c15a30e4119fe5985c61f1e8278cb OP_EQUAL
address
MAytoNbgYkkxjicxbVcrkEcXvcF7dQPUyS
transaction
8c88a397196e3086d54ca2b5fe711466bd118b348624061dc7fb7dac17578384
spent
true